Nintendo Fiber Optic Sign - Animated Store Display
Model #NESM36F - Double sided logo artwork
Has factory loops to hang or sits nicely on a shelf.
$400/SHIPPED obo or it goes to ebay which I feel will bring the same amount or more.
32" Wide - 12" Height - 6" Depth
Inside the magic happens with a motor running a lighted disc, which colors and animates the fiber optic lights on the front of the sign. The sign changes colors between Red and white repeating the sparkly animation effect every few seconds. The backside of the sign is Nintendo logo only and does not light up. The backside has a few light scratches and scuffs pictured (exaggerated) but very clean and presentable. This is a metal framed display sign. 100% working and 100% of all the fiber optics function property.
Most of these M36 factory display signs have the text "World of" light up. This one does not have the "World of Nintendo" script only the Nintendo logo. This sign is slimmer, cleaner, takes up less space and visually is much more appealing to me.
